Android安卓系統的安全性通過多種機制和技術得到保障,旨在保護用戶數據和設備免受未授權訪問和其他安全威脅。以下是一些關鍵的安全保障措施:
- 應用沙盒機制:每個應用程序都在獨立的沙箱環境中運行,限制應用程序之間的相互影響,減少惡意軟件的傳播。
- 應用簽名機制:規定APK文件必須被開發者進行數字簽名,以便標識應用程序作者和在應用程序之間的信任關系。
- 權限聲明機制:應用程序需要聲明其所需的權限,用戶在安裝或運行時需要授權這些權限,從而限制應用程序訪問敏感數據和功能。
- 進程通信機制:基于共享內存的Binder實現,提供輕量級的遠程進程調用(RPC),確保進程間通信的數據不會溢出越界。
- 內存管理機制:基于Linux的低內存管理機制,設計實現了獨特的LMK,將進程重要性分級、分組,當內存不足時,自動清理級別進程所占用的內存空間。
Android安卓系統通過這些安全措施,為用戶提供了多層次的安全保護,確保了用戶數據和設備的安全。